General Contractors DefinitionGeneral Contractors manage construction projects and oversee subcontractors while ensuring compliance with regulations and licensing. Native Sons Home Services works with general https://keithbodq226431.blogzag.com/83719883/methods-to-effectively-handle-your-main-contractor